Web16. jan 2011 · Literate people have three vocabularies, as I tell my students each semester. One is relatively small; one is medium-sized, and one is quite large. Think “The Three Bears.”. Our smallest vocabulary is our speaking vocabulary. The middle-sized vocabulary is our writing vocabulary. Our largest vocabulary is – or at least, is supposed to be ...

Web13. aug 2024 · One reason that English has a larger vocabulary is that it is a language with Germanic origins but tremendous Latin influence, an influence so great that sometimes English seems more like French than it does like Danish, another Germanic language.
